Nomenclature (4)

  • Dawsonites Buckton, 1891d: pl.F. (fossil)

    type species by original monotypy † Dawsonites veter Buckton, 1891

  • Dawsonites Scudder, 1895a: 18. (fossil)

    type species by original monotypy † Dawsonites veter Scudder, 1895

  • Dawsonites Scudder, 1895 (homonym of † Dawsonites Buckton, 1891) in Metcalf & Wade, 1966a: 203.
  • Dawsonites Scudder, 1895 (subjective synonym of † Dawsonites Buckton, 1891) in Metcalf & Wade, 1966a: 203.

Nomenclature references (3)

  • Buckton, G.B. (1891d) Monograph of the British Cicadae, or Tettigiidae, illustrated by more than four hundred coloured drawings. Macmillan. London, Vol. 2, Issue VIII, pp. 129–211 + pls. E-H, lxix-lxxiv.
  • Metcalf, Z.P. & Wade, V. (1966a) General catalogue of the Homoptera. A supplement to Fascicle I - Membracidae of the general catalogue of the Hemiptera. A catalogue of the fossil Homoptera. (Homoptera: Auchenorrhyncha). USA: Waverly Press, Inc. Baltimore, MD, V + 245 p.
  • Scudder, S.H. (1895a) Canadian fossil insects. I. The Tertiary Hemiptera of British Columbia. Contributions to Canadian Palaeontology, 2, 5–26.

Gender, form, and etymology

Etymology:

in honor of John William Dawson, (1820–1899), a Canadian geologist + -ites (Greek: -ίτης, descendant, belonging to the group of)
